3. Any position is fair game

There’s no right or wrong way to have s3x when you’re pregnant—you’re not going to crush the baby doing missionary or lying on your belly. Just choose the position that feels good for you. That said, “rear entry or woman on top seem to be more comfortable,” Dr. Minkin notes.

4. It’s normal if you don’t feel like it…

While intercourse is totally fair game while you’re pregnant, don’t be surprised if you’re just not in the mood. Women have less s3x in the third trimester than in any other, studies show, probably because they’re so physically bulky and tired by that point, Dr. Minkin says. Then there’s the release of the hormone prolactin, which occurs all throughout pregnancy and may reduce libido. Body image can also do a number on you; so much of libido is psychological, and it’s possible that your rapidly changing shape could have you feeling out of sorts in your own skin, and less attractive as a result (though say it with us—you are one gorgeous mama, extra pounds and all).
